The Merry Lion

The Merry Lion is Singapore's only full-time comedy club. We are open 5 days a week from 6pm - midnight. Most shows start around 8pm and the bar is open to everyone until then. Shows are priced from $0 (free) to $50 depending on what is on offer. Acts come from all over the world to perform at The Merry Lion. We also help develop local talent with our open mic nights. Tipple and Dram

Tipple and Dram opened its doors in May 2018. This plush two-level bar occupies a quaint shop house! Injecting vim and vigor in this neighborhood teeming with great bars and restaurants what sets Tipple and Dram apart is that, guests can have unique and different experiences at one venue, in one evening! Tipple is the charming street level bar – an inviting space with both indoor and outdoor seating. Showcasing an über-selective wine menu,wide spectrum of spirits, craft beers on tap and de rigueur hand-crafted cocktails. Dram, occupies the basement of the shop house and lends a very plush feel with it's wooden decor, leather fittings, subdued lighting complimented by soft jazz music. It reflects understated elegance and leads into a dreamy world where guests and whisky connoisseurs get to sample extremely rare, limited-edition malts and unique bottlings available at distilleries only! Enjoy these with food pairings such as Bak Kwa and a great selection of cigars to choose from!

1-Altitude Gallery & Bar

1-Altitude Gallery & Bar stands at a peak of 282 metres and boasts a spectacular 360-degree view of Singapore. Located at the top of 1-Altitude -- a multi-concept lifestyle destination in Singapore that stretches across the 61st to 63rd floor of One Raffles Place, 1-Altitude Gallery brings you an experience like no other, simply on top of the world. The work of acclaimed designer, Ed Poole, 1-Altitude is decked out in contemporary custom decor and furniture, including ‘first in the world rattan style furniture with LED light effects. As the sun sets, experience musical euphoria with both 1-Altitude's resident live bands and DJs. Notably the world's highest al-fresco bar, 1-Altitude presents a world class sunset and nightlife destination with an expansive cocktail menu for Singapore's a-list parties and happenings.
